Lahore: The Anti-Terrorism Court Lahore has extended the interim bails Imran Khan's sisters Aleema Khan and Uzma Khan in six cases of May 09 including the Jinnah House arson attack.
According to details, the interim bails of Shah Mahmood Qureshi, Fawad Chaudhry and Asad Umar have also been extended in the same cases.
ATC Judge Ejaz Ahmed Buttar heard six cases when Shah Mehmood Qureshi, Asad Umar, Aleema Khan and Uzma Khan reached the court after their interim bails had expired. Court has asked the police for records.
Advocate Rana Mudassar said in his arguments that the accused have been investigated, the court should order to confirm the interim bail of the accused.
The lawyer further said that Shah Mehmood Qureshi, Aleema Khan, Uzma Khan and Asad Umar are not involved in any incident.
